iti-ict / wakamiti

BDD testing tool using step libraries
https://iti-ict.github.io/wakamiti/
Mozilla Public License 2.0
33 stars 5 forks source link

La fecha/hora de ejecución en los JSON no respeta el timezone #208

Open linesta-iti opened 1 year ago

linesta-iti commented 1 year ago

Cuando se genera el JSON de salida, los valores de startInstant y finishInstant no respetan el estándar ISO 8601.

Por ejemplo ,para un plan ejecutado el 2023-09-11 a las 10:25:46.583 en España, el valor escrito es :

2023-09-11T10:25:46.583Z cuando este valor en realidad hace referencia a la zona horaria UTC 0 y no a la de España,el instante correcto tendría que ser 2023-09-11T08:25:46.583Z.

Esto en principio no tiene mayor relevancia excepto cuando estos valores se pasan a otros sistemas que sí tienen en cuenta la zona horaria.

Se propone el siguiente cambio:

linesta-iti commented 1 year ago

Cuando se genera el JSON de salida, los valores de startInstant y finishInstant no respetan el estándar ISO 8601.

Por ejemplo ,para un plan ejecutado el 2023-09-11 a las 10:25:46.583 en España, el valor escrito es :

2023-09-11T10:25:46.583Z cuando este valor en realidad hace referencia a la zona horaria UTC 0 y no a la de España,el instante correcto tendría que ser 2023-09-11T08:25:46.583Z.

Esto en principio no tiene mayor relevancia excepto cuando estos valores se pasan a otros sistemas que sí tienen en cuenta la zona horaria.

Se propone el siguiente cambio: